In August 2021, John Whelan joined Yale University as Vice President and Chief Human Resources Officer (CHRO), embracing a pivotal role aligned with Yale’s mission of “improving the world today and for future generations through outstanding research and scholarship, education, preservation, and practice.” John leads an accomplished HR organization dedicated to fostering a workforce as diverse and talented as it is engaged with Yale’s global mission. His approach to HR leadership is to cultivate a community where every individual contributes to creating a better world.

Before Yale, John served Indiana University as Vice President and CHRO, where he elevated HR into a strategic asset. This period was characterized by improvements in process efficiency, customer service, and a notable increase in employee engagement across its seven campuses, underscoring John’s belief in the transformative power of effective HR practices.

Before Indiana University, John served as the Vice President and CHRO at Baylor University, where he continued his commitment to HR excellence. His journey in HR leadership also includes impactful roles at the University of Notre Dame, Bristol-Myers Squibb, The Gillette Company, and Brown Brothers Harriman & Co. At each stage of his career, John has championed positive change, emphasizing the importance of listening, learning, and leading with empathy and strategic vision.

Holding both a BA and a JD from the University of Notre Dame, John has a profound respect for the human and legal dimensions of HR. His leadership extends to contributions within the broader HR community, including his previous service on the national board of directors for the College and University Professional Association for Human Resources (CUPA-HR), where he also served as chair. Notably, John was honored with CUPA-HR's Donald E. Dickason Award in 2021, the most prestigious recognition for an HR professional in higher education. Recently concluding his term as chair for the American Research Universities-HR Institute (ARU-HRI), John continues to serve on its board.

As a member of the Massachusetts Bar Association, John upholds the highest standards of integrity and professionalism. His collaborative leadership and dedication to meaningful change are central to his role at Yale, where he works tirelessly to advance the university's mission of making a lasting impact on the world.
